Marvellous effort, says Johnny
13:06, 17 September 2008
Around £1,000 was raised at a late summer fete held at the Thanet Day Opportunity Service day centre for adults with learning and physical disabilities at Tivoli Road, Margate.
The fun event was officially opened by kmfm for Thanet breakfast show presenter Johnny Lewis, and included a disco, barbecue, stalls, bric-a-brac and tombola.
He said: “It was a fantastic fete and the organisers put on a really good show.
"There’s only one word to describe the effort to raise £1000 for a really worthwhile cause - marvellous.”
